Aug 11, 2023 · The 1971 no-S Jefferson proof nickel is another valuable coin with no mint mark. These coins were only minted in San Francisco, but the rare no-S variety were struck without the mint mark. Only 200 no-S proof nickels are known to exist. This is the only coin in the entire Jefferson Nickel collection that was struck without a mint mark. From 1946 to 1964, the Roosevelt dimes were composed of 90% silver and 10% copper. In 1964, the US Mint struck the last dimes that contained 90% silver. The US Mint still makes Roosevelt dimes for circulation, but these coins are now composed of a copper-nickel alloy. The 1975 No S 10 Cents is part of a series of Roosevelt dime coins struck from 1946-Present. Struck in San Francisco and designated as a Proof (PR) strike, this coin is made of 75% copper; 25% nickel. The proof issues of the Roosevelt dim series have been minted from 1950 to present.
